如何监控网页的性能表现?

在当今数字化时代,网页作为企业展示自身形象、提供服务的窗口,其性能表现直接影响到用户体验和企业的品牌形象。如何有效监控网页的性能表现,确保其稳定运行,成为了一个至关重要的问题。本文将围绕这一主题,从多个角度探讨如何对网页性能进行监控,帮助企业和开发者提升网页质量。

一、了解网页性能指标

1. 响应时间

响应时间是指用户发起请求到页面完全加载的时间。响应时间是衡量网页性能的重要指标之一,过长的响应时间会导致用户流失。

2. 吞吐量

吞吐量是指单位时间内服务器处理的请求数量。吞吐量反映了服务器的处理能力,对于高流量网站尤为重要。

3. 资源加载时间

资源加载时间是指页面中各种资源(如图片、CSS、JavaScript等)的加载时间。资源加载时间过长会影响页面加载速度,降低用户体验。

4. 网页崩溃率

网页崩溃率是指页面在用户访问过程中崩溃的频率。网页崩溃率过高会影响用户体验,降低用户对企业的信任度。

二、监控网页性能的方法

1. 使用浏览器开发者工具

浏览器开发者工具如Chrome DevTools、Firefox Developer Tools等,可以帮助开发者实时监控网页性能。通过分析网络请求、资源加载时间等数据,开发者可以找出性能瓶颈,并进行优化。

2. 使用性能监控工具

性能监控工具如Google PageSpeed Insights、Lighthouse等,可以自动分析网页性能,并提供优化建议。这些工具可以帮助开发者快速了解网页性能状况,并针对性地进行优化。

3. 使用服务器端监控工具

服务器端监控工具如Nginx、Apache等,可以监控服务器性能,包括CPU、内存、磁盘等资源使用情况。通过分析服务器性能数据,可以找出服务器瓶颈,优化服务器配置。

4. 使用第三方监控平台

第三方监控平台如New Relic、Datadog等,可以全面监控网页性能,包括前端、后端、数据库等方面。这些平台通常提供可视化界面,方便开发者直观了解性能状况。

三、案例分析

案例一:优化图片资源

某电商网站首页加载速度较慢,经过分析发现,图片资源加载时间过长是主要原因。通过对图片进行压缩、使用CDN等技术,将图片资源加载时间缩短了50%,从而提升了页面加载速度。

案例二:优化数据库查询

某企业内部管理系统数据库查询速度较慢,导致用户体验不佳。通过优化数据库查询语句、索引优化等技术,将数据库查询速度提升了30%,从而提高了系统性能。

四、总结

监控网页性能表现是提升用户体验、优化网站质量的重要手段。通过了解网页性能指标、掌握多种监控方法,并针对问题进行优化,可以有效提升网页性能。希望本文能对您有所帮助。

猜你喜欢:应用故障定位